Abstract {\it Pattern recognition with supplementary information} is a new pattern recognition framework to avoid unavoidable errors. It determines an output class by combining a feature vector extracted from the pattern and a small {\it hint} on the true class. The hint called {\it supplementary information} is freely designed so as to minimize the error rate. Under the assumption that supplementary information is infallible, an approximately best assignment of the information is derived. In this paper, we derive a general assignments methodology of both fallible and infallible supplementary information.
